The La Paz evaluation project was initiated by the University of Arizona's Department of Residence Life & University Housing and office of Campus and Facilities Planning (Facilities Division). The work of the project was conducted by a faculty member of the School of Architecture, College of Architecture, Planning and Landscape Architecture, University of Arizona, Tucson.
